B19F0 Jeep Code - Right Power Sliding Door Latch Control 1 Circuit High
Quick Answer
When the Right Power Sliding Door Latch Motor Cinch/Release output is pulled high prior to or during a latch cinch or release operation for over 100ms, this code will set. Common causes include Faulty Right Cinch/Release Motor Latch, Right Cinch/Release Motor Latch harness is open or shorted, Right Cinch/Release Motor Latch circuit poor electrical connection. Severity is High - diagnose this code as soon as possible. Driving is not recommended if the warning light is flashing, the engine runs poorly, or safety-related symptoms are present.

What are the Possible Causes of the DTC B19F0 Jeep?
- Faulty Right Cinch/Release Motor Latch
- Right Cinch/Release Motor Latch harness is open or shorted
- Right Cinch/Release Motor Latch circuit poor electrical connection
- Faulty Right Rear Door Latch Assembly
- Faulty Right Rear Door Module
How to Fix the DTC B19F0 Jeep?
Review the 'Possible Causes' above and visually examine the corresponding wiring harness and connectors. Check for damaged components and inspect connector pins for signs of being broken, bent, pushed out, or corroded.
